Abstract

Despite the increasing number of Indonesian postgraduate students studying overseas, including in the United Kingdom, not many studies have been done on their intercultural communication experiences and academic engagement. This research aims to investigate Indonesian postgraduate students’ intercultural communication experiences and academic engagement in the United Kingdom. In this study, we address the following research question: What are the hindering factors and the facilitating factors of Indonesian postgraduate students’ academic engagement within their courses of study? A qualitative research method is used in this study, based on semi-structured interviews with 13 participants. The results of the study indicate that the students are more engaged in some areas, such applying deep learning strategies by connecting ideas, and less engaged in others, such as interacting with academic staff. Several interrelated factors were indicated as contributing to facilitating or hindering academic engagement which include sociocultural, institutional, and individual factors. The hindering factors consists of the transition to a new academic environment, intense academic workload, ‘expert’ or ‘boring tutors, linguistic barriers, and having feelings of uneasiness. Conversely, the facilitating factors consist of institutional support service, course design, caring and casual tutors, learning from prior experiences, having the initiative to ask, and realizing to make the most of the opportunity.

Abstract

Stunting mencerminkan kondisi gagal tumbuh pada anak balita (bawah 5 tahun) akibat kekurangan gizi kronis, sehingga anak menjadi terlalu pendek untuk usianya. Stunting dapat menimbulkan dampak serius baik mikro (individu) maupun makro (masyarakat). Kabupaten garut merupakan salah satu kabupaten dengan tingkat prevelensi stunting tertinggi di Jawa Barat sebesar 43 persen. Tingginya angka prevelensi stunting ini tidak lepas dari pengetahuan dan sikap masyarkat (ibu muda) yang rendah tentang penting pencegahan stunting. Rendahnya pengetahuan ibu muda di Kabupaten Garut tidak lepas dari rendahnya literas tentang pola hidup sehat dan pencegahan stunting. Metode Pengabdian pada masyarkaat ini dilakukan dengan beberapa kegiatan yang terdiri dari metode komunikasi bermedia dengan penayangan materi “sosialiasi literasi, metode ceramah, metode interaktif dan evaluasi metode pre test dan post test. Hasil pengabdian menunjukkan bahwa peserta pelatihan memiliki pemahaman dan literasi yang rendah dalam pencegahan stunting, kurang memahami factor penyebab stunting. Kegiatan pengabdian ini meningkatkan atau melakukan penguatan terhadap pengetahuan, sikap dan literasi individu/ibu muda dalam pencegahan stunting. Hasil evaluasi menunjukan adanya perubahan pengetahuan, dan sikap, serta antusiasme ibu dalam pencegahan stunting.

Abstract

The Covid-19 pandemic has disrupted educational communication, as traditional teaching and learning have been replaced by online digital teaching and learning. Thus, teachers must adapt quickly to new technology to meet the lesson objectives and successfully deliver their lessons. This study explores teachers’ adaptation experience throughout the Covid-19 pandemic. Data was gathered in Mutiara Bunda Elementary School, an inclusive private school in Bandung with religious education at its core. In-depth interviews and introspection were conducted with four Islamic education teachers across grades. Thematic analysis was used to analyse the data. The findings revealed that teachers went through five overlapping stages: confusion, trial and error, capacity building, adaptation, and efforts to find new solutions. However, different challenges were faced by each teacher according to the grades they taught. Even though teachers had finally adapted and transformed the teaching and learning experience, traditional face-to-face communication was still preferred by 1st to 3rd-grade teachers to deliver the lessons effectively. Lack of the teachers’ IT skills to deliver the lessons to develop the students’ character, inexperience in online teaching, and the students’ low motivation to learn through the digital platform clearly constitute the main obstacle in this religious, educational process.

Abstract

Ruangguru is a digital media learning application created by a startup that understands Generation Z. It provides teaching materials for elementary, junior high, and high school children that can be accessed via Android, iOS, and PC (Windows and macOS), as part of their daily use. This breakthrough was made to maintain school-aged children’s interest and motivation to learn, as Ruangguru carries the tagline: Belajar Jadi Luar Biasa (Learning Becomes Extraordinary) through facilities such as videos, practice exercises, private lessons, as well as tryouts. The novelty in this study lies in the concept of "Master Teacher". Based on the observation and interviews conducted, Ruangguru uses the term "Master Teacher" to refer to the instructors, which raises an understanding of the quality instructors Ruangguru has. Therefore, the researchers intend to reveal the Master Teacher’s learning strategy during the online learning process through digital media. The objectives of this study are as follows: 1) to explore the Master Teacher’s learning strategy while preparing interesting digital media-based applications; 2) to identify Ruangguru’s target audience 3) to explore reasons for using Master Teacher as part of the learning strategy. The research has used case study as a qualitative method to collect data through interviews, observation, and literature studies. The results of this study indicate that: 1) Ruangguru as a learning application provides content for various levels in an interesting way through videos, practice questions, private lessons, tryouts which can be accessed from a smartphone; 2) Ruangguru’s content is adapted from the national curriculum and specifically designed by the best and experienced teachers. It is aimed at Generation Z ranging from elementary, junior high, to high school students; 3) Master Teacher (MT), as Ruangguru’s strong point, serves as a representative in delivering digital media-based transformative learning strategies to Generation Z; 4) Transformative learning strategy is used by Ruangguru Master Teacher (MT) because it suits Generation Z’s characteristics that like Ruangguru’s digital media as a platform to deliver messages. Since the urgency and potential of learning through digital media are considered as an important finding in this research, it is recommended that the results of this study are utilized, disseminated, and developed in learning processes.

Abstract

Kindergarten (PAUD) as a second learning vehicle after the family environment for early childhood, gives a distinct impression for those who experience it. As a place to play while learning that is full of educational values, it should provide varied learning. Especially in the current digital era, early childhood learning media must also be developed. This is the reason we carry out Community Service (PkM) activities targeting early childhood children in an early childhood education center located in Ciparagejaya village, Karawang district. Its location close to the coast, becomes a learning vehicle for the people who are there. Therefore, we also carried out PkM activities with the title "Improving Early Childhood Creativity through Games as Creative Learning Media Education in PAUD Ciparagejaya Village, Karawang Regency". The purpose of implementing PkM is to increase the creativity of early childhood in the PAUD environment through creative learning media education. The PkM method used is the roleplay method and the participatory method, where children are directly involved in learning activities through games as a form of creative learning media education. The results obtained indicate the active participation of children in the learning process, train children's creativity through creative learning media stimuli, and instill moral values in the form of honesty, self-confidence, as well as perseverance and enthusiasm for learning.

Abstract

The tourism awareness movement is an important aspect that must be developed in realising the development of tourism villages in Jatigede sub-district. This can be realised with the support of the local community. Therefore, the PPM programme carried out by the Communication Science Study Programme is to encourage the potential for increasing the village tourism awareness movement in Jatigede sub-district. In addition, according to the concept of tourism management, tourism in the village can also be institutionalised through the existence of Tourism Awareness Groups which will be an important force in managing tourism potential by collaborating with other parties in the village. This Community Service Programme (PPM) has been carried out in the October-November 2023 period with various series of activities. The purpose of this PPM is to create a Tourism Awareness Group (Pokdarwis) in the Jatigede area in the future. Prodi Ilkom conducted a series of surveys of village potential up to the monitoring and evaluation stage as the final PPM activity. PPM activities run smoothly supported by collaboration with the sub-district and others in the village chosen as the object of PPM Prodi Ilkom. The five villages are Kadujaya village, Cijeungjing village, Jemah village, Karedok village, and Cipicung village. The success indicators of the PPM activities were shown by the enthusiasm of the participants in following the PPM series and the initiation of Tourism Awareness Groups in some of these villages.
